    Quote Originally Posted by Texan Penguin View Post
    So dumb question- should we be taking the Chargers a bit more seriously as a contender this year if they can hold the Chiefs into OT? I didn't see anything but the last five minutes of regulation, just the impression I got mixed with what I already know about both teams.
    The Chiefs are actually not a team that dominates. They were getting blown out by the Texans in the first round at one point. They were getting beat by the Titans in the AFC title game at one point. They were trailing the 49ers in the Super Bowl in the 4th quarter by 2 scores. What the Chiefs have is Patrick Mahomes, who tends to go on tilt at some point in the game and pile up touchdowns to erase a load of mistakes by the team. He is a cheat code.

    If I understand correctly, cutting Cousins would result in something like $40 million in dead money. Plus they just extended both Spielman and Zimmer.

    Honestly, my only hope is that they tank real bad, convince Cousins to renegotiate his contract to free up cap room, pick up Lawrence but have him sit a year while Cousins plays out the rest of his contract, then get rid of all 3 and rebuild with a new coach and GM around Lawrence.

    The only comfort from the game yesterday is it got all of the folks who kept saying that the offense was fine and the defense is why we lost to the Packers to admit they were wrong. I knew when they signed Cousins he'd be a lead necklace for the team. The amount they had to pay him was no where near the performance they'd get, and it'd lead to salary cap issues that would cripple the team for the next few years. Sure enough that's exactly what happened, and now they're paying for an Aaron Rodgers and getting a Matt Cassell.

    *EDIT*

    Just looked it up, the only way they don't pay a stupid amount of money to cut Cousin's before the 21-22 offseason is if they can trade him to another team by June 1st so they only have $10 million in dead cap money. And if they wait until June 1st, then it goes from $41 mil to an absurd $60 mil in dead cap.
